Emma Sleep Canada Original: Firmness and comfort

The Emma Sleep Canada Original mattress is rated 5 out of 10 on the firmness scale, according to Emma.

A soft-medium mattress like the Emma Canada Original is best suited to:

  • People of light to average weight.

  • Individuals who tend to sleep on their side.

  • Those who like a softer sleep surface.

But the softer feel isn't for everyone, and some Emma Sleep Canada reviews comment that the Original mattress is too soft.

Firmness and sleeping positions
The softer Emma Canada Original is one of the best mattresses for side and back sleepers but would be too soft for stomach sleepers.

Heavier people and those who favour sleeping on their stomachs need something firmer than this mattress.

Is the Emma Sleep Canada Original comfortable?

The Emma Canada Original is a high-quality mattress considered comfortable by many. 🤗

Though it may also not be the best mattress if you often sit on the edge of your bed as it only has average edge support - spring mattresses like the Emma Hybrid are better for this.

It's also worth noting that comfort is subjective and is heavily affected by factors like firmness.

Research conducted by Good Morning and Douglas showed that 73% of Canadians polled preferred a medium to firm-feeling mattress [1].

The Emma Sleep Canada Original may not be the best match if you prefer something firmer.

Mattress firmness spinal alignment
Mattresses that are too soft or firm cannot support optimal spinal alignment.

Sinking in too much or too little may cause bending in the spine, aggravating back pain. ❤️‍🩹

But the firmness and overall feeling of a mattress can vary depending on your weight. ⚖️

So, the same mattress will likely feel firmer to a lighter-weight individual, who doesn’t sink into the surface much, than to a heavier person, who will sink further into the mattress.

The Emma Canada Original is a foam mattress.

hand imprint memory foam mattress
Memory foam mattresses are famous for their 'memory effect'.

Memory foam mattresses retain heat, allowing them to mould to your body and provide excellent pressure relief and support.

The down side is that hot sleepers may find foam mattresses like this too warm for a good night’s sleep.

While it sleeps warm, memory foam provides outstanding motion isolation.

low motion transfer mattress
Mattresses with low motion transfer stop movements from being carried and felt across the surface.

This makes it ideal for couples, especially those whose partner is on a different sleep schedule or who frequently change positions during the night.

By absorbing movement, foam mattresses ensure an undisturbed night’s sleep.

Emma Sleep Canada Original: Composition

The Emma Sleep Canada Original mattress has an all-foam design.

This means it is highly adaptive, contouring around your body to provide tailored support as and where you need it. 🤗

All the foams used are CertiPUR-US certified [2].

The mattress has 5 layers.

These include (from top to bottom):

  1. Mattress cover

  2. Point elastic Airgocell foam

  3. Halo memory foam

  4. HRX high resiliency extra foam

  5. Anti-slip base cover

Before we dive into these layers, it's worth pointing out there have been some claims of dishonest descriptions on the Emma CA website, with some sections referring to the mattress's 5 layers and others discussing 3.

However, this is simply because some sections include the cover and base, whereas others only refer to the foam layers.

2. Point elastic Airgocell foam

Foam mattresses tend to sleep hot. 🥵

They are designed to react to heat and mould around your body, which also means they retain heat and allow less air circulation.

The point elastic Airgocell foam layer which tops the mattress helps counteract this by enhancing breathability and temperature regulation. 👍

It absorbs and evaporates sweat, meaning less heat is stored in the mattress.

Original Airgocell foam
The spongey Airgocell layer offers enhanced temperature regulation compared to ordinary memory foam.

This improved temperature regulation is essential as studies show we sleep best when we don't overheat [3].

3. Halo memory foam

The memory foam layer offers excellent tailored support.

It provides enhanced spinal support, allowing heavier parts of the body (like the shoulders and hips) to sink further into the mattress. 💗

This keeps your spine in a continuously neutral position.

Woman with back pain
The wrong mattress can lead to back and joint pain since it does not offer the support needed.

By contouring around your body, this memory foam layer also offers better pressure relief, preventing build-ups which could lead to joint and back pain.

4. HRX foam

The HRX foam layer is a 'high resiliency extra' foam.

It is designed to enhance durability and stability. 💪

This layer also features 3 cutout zones to better support the various areas of the body.

Emma Sleep trials and guarantees

One of the best things about the Emma Sleep company is its mattress trials and guarantees.

Emma Sleep Canada mattress trial

All Emma mattresses come with a year-long trial.

This is the same as better-known Canadian brands like Douglas.

Emma requires customers to sleep on the mattress for at least 21 nights (up to 365 nights), ensuring you have plenty of time to adjust and decide if you love your new Emma mattress. 🤔

Mattress trial process
You have a year to sleep on your new mattress to see if it’s right.

If you don’t love it, you can return your mattress for a full refund under the Emma trial.

We recommend using a mattress protector as mattresses with stains, tears, or odours are not eligible for return under the Emma trial period. ❌

BUY EMMA ORIGINAL£ 674

Emma Sleep Canada mattress guarantees

All Emma mattresses in Canada also come with a 10-year guarantee.

This warranty covers any faults such as dipping or lumps.

While Emma's customer service can be slow (and sometimes poor), customers in other markets have generally found that the mattress guarantee is honoured.

But bear in mind this process isn’t always as easy as it should be. 😞

  • Emma vs Endy: Which is better?


    Emma and Endy's original mattresses are similar.

    Both are all-foam mattresses featuring 3 foam layers, including a top breathable foam.

    Price-wise, these mattresses are very similar.

    However, Emma Sleep Canada runs frequent discounts, making it a better choice if you’re looking for the most affordable option (so long as you can time your purchase with one of these many sales).

    When it comes to manufacturing, Endy mattresses are made in Canada, while Emma Canada mattresses are made in Mexico.

    An Endy mattress Canada is usually firmer than its Emma counterpart.

    When it comes to trials and guarantees, things are pretty even.

    Emma Sleep CA offers a longer sleep trial, 365 days vs 100 days for Endy mattresses.

    However, Endy offers a longer warranty, 15 years, compared to Emma Canada’s 10.

  • Why is my Emma mattress sinking in the middle?


    If your Emma mattress is sinking in the middle, it could be due to the natural ageing of the mattress, as most have a lifespan of 10-12 years

    Or the issue might stem from an unsuitable or worn-out bed base

    Ensuring your Emma mattress rests on a proper, flat, and supportive surface can help maintain even support and prevent sagging.

    Alternatively, you may have a faulty Emma mattress Canada.

    If you notice a fault, contact customer services via Emma-sleep.ca to discuss getting a replacement mattress under the Emma 10-year guarantee.

  • Should you flip an Emma mattress?


    You should not flip an Emma mattress.

    Emma mattresses have a one-sided design.

    To help keep your mattress in top shape, we recommend rotating your Emma mattress every 4 to 6 months.
